Thinking of signin up and get the $74 SSL package, a few questions:

1. Can I have my ssl certificate bound to abc.mydomain.com, instead of the traditional 'www'?

2. Can I have yet another ssl certificate bound to 123.mydomain.com, under the same account? Any limit on the number of sub-domains that links to a SSL package?

3. Which root-CA does the $74 package include?

4. Would you pass me the private key ring and the signed cert?

Here are the answers of your questions in the way you asked them :

1. Yes indeed you can have your SSL certificate for domain name abc.mydomain.com instead of the main domain name.
2. Unfortunately you can have only one SSL certificate per account.
3. The $74 package includes Equifax Secure Global eBusiness CA-1
4. You are not quite clear with this question - if you are going to buy a certificate with SiteGround.com you might not need the RSA Key and the Cert File.

Thanks for your answers. For question #4, what I mean is, if I buy the SSL package from your side and I decide to move to another hosting someday later on, can I get back my private key and signed cert (so that I can use it in the new hosting provider)?

Yes indeed it is your private SSL and in case you decide to move to another host your SSL Certificate and RSA Key File will be provided to you as soon as you request.
